Output ab4f6657d06fe9c34da63e52a4d6f835f3196b9b88b47fe57e73d83d90978365:42

value
21653128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1c1f46ff304f4437ce458e691e2765be74de734 OP_EQUAL
address
MVwTRsxW9M4X1CW4auo1NUCB3TFUxJkoju
transaction
ab4f6657d06fe9c34da63e52a4d6f835f3196b9b88b47fe57e73d83d90978365
spent
true